Citi Field Concert Seating: A Guide to Finding the Perfect Spot

Citi Field, home of the New York Mets, transforms into a vibrant concert venue throughout the year, hosting some of the biggest names in music. But with its expansive layout, choosing the right seats can be crucial for an unforgettable experience. This guide will help you navigate the seating chart and find the perfect spot for your next Citi Field concert.

Understanding Citi Field's Concert Configuration:

Unlike baseball games, concert seating at Citi Field is typically configured to maximize views of the stage. This means fewer obstructed views compared to a standard baseball game setup. However, understanding the different seating sections is still key.

Key Seating Areas & Their Pros & Cons:

  • Field Level (Floor Seats): These are the closest seats to the stage, offering an unparalleled, intimate concert experience.

    • Pros: Closest views, immersive atmosphere, often includes VIP amenities.
    • Cons: Most expensive, can be crowded, less comfortable seating than upper levels.
  • Lower Level (100 Level): Located above the field level, these seats still offer excellent views, particularly in the center sections.

    • Pros: Great views, more affordable than floor seats, relatively comfortable seating.
    • Cons: Further from the stage than floor seats.
  • Upper Level (200 & 300 Levels): These offer a broader view of the stage and the entire field.

    • Pros: Most affordable option, good overall view, less crowded.
    • Cons: Furthest from the stage, smaller viewing angle.
  • Club Level (Various Locations): Often offering premium amenities like access to lounges, dedicated bars, and upscale restrooms.

    • Pros: Enhanced comfort, VIP amenities, often better views than upper levels.
    • Cons: Most expensive option.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Your Seats:

  • Your Budget: Prices vary significantly depending on the seating location and the artist. Set a budget beforehand to narrow your options.
  • Your Preferred View: Do you prioritize being close to the stage, or do you prefer a wider view of the entire performance?
  • Your Comfort Level: Consider factors like seating comfort, accessibility, and proximity to restrooms and concessions.
  • The Artist: Some artists utilize the entire stage, making upper-level seats perfectly acceptable. Others may focus more on the center stage, making lower-level seats more desirable.

Tips for Finding the Best Seats:

  • Use Interactive Seating Charts: Ticket vendors typically provide interactive seating charts that allow you to see the view from each section.
  • Read Reviews: Check online reviews from previous concertgoers to get an idea of the pros and cons of different seating areas.
  • Buy Tickets Early: The best seats often sell out quickly, so it's best to buy your tickets as early as possible.
  • Consider Resale Markets: If you miss out on initial ticket sales, reputable resale markets like StubHub or Ticketmaster's Fan-to-Fan Resale can sometimes offer good deals.

Beyond the Seats: Enhancing Your Citi Field Concert Experience:

  • Plan Your Transportation: Citi Field is easily accessible by public transportation, but consider traffic and parking if driving.
  • Check the Venue's Policies: Familiarize yourself with Citi Field's policies on bags, prohibited items, and other regulations.
  • Arrive Early: Arriving early allows you to get settled in, explore the venue, and grab a drink or snack before the show begins.
